Transaction

0aef58242b6e000ca34c55c4993395820e141d579aaafd4d8dd97958d9d7910c

Summary

In Block573986
TimeFri, 16 Feb 2024 22:29:30 UTC
Total Input581.82291666 Nebula
Total Output615.82291666 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
402287 Confirmations615.82291666 Nebula
Raw Transaction